When she appeared at The Hague last Thursday, she claimed her presence at the Liberian dictator's trial was an inconvenience, an assertion which drew gasps from the court.

Campbell then went on to say she had received 'two or three' diamonds in the middle of the night but did not know they were from Taylor.

She said she had handed them over to Nelson Mandela's children's charity, which had been hosting the event she attended with the former Liberian president.

The model's evidence was today contradicted by both actress Mia Farrow and Campbell's former agent Carole White.

They claimed she had always known that the diamonds were from Charles Taylor.
